Causes of moral intuitions sorting_complete, difficult

Completion requirements

In this sorting activity, students explore different causes of six important moral intuitions of humans. This activity is more difficult because text boxes are not organized by kind of cause.
The activity is inspired by Haidt, J. (2012). The Righteous Mind: Why Good People Are Divided by Politics and Religion. New York, NY, USA: Pantheon Books. (Fig. 6.2)
